package org.apache.commons.pool2.impl;

import java.security.AccessController;
import java.security.PrivilegedAction;
import java.util.TimerTask;
import java.util.concurrent.ScheduledFuture;
import java.util.concurrent.ScheduledThreadPoolExecutor;
import java.util.concurrent.ThreadFactory;
import java.util.concurrent.TimeUnit;

/**
 * Provides a shared idle object eviction timer for all pools.
 * 

* This class is currently implemented using {@link ScheduledThreadPoolExecutor}. This implementation may change in any * future release. This class keeps track of how many pools are using it. If no pools are using the timer, it is * cancelled. This prevents a thread being left running which, in application server environments, can lead to memory * leads and/or prevent applications from shutting down or reloading cleanly. *

*

* This class has package scope to prevent its inclusion in the pool public API. The class declaration below should * *not* be changed to public. *

*

* This class is intended to be thread-safe. *

* * @since 2.0 */ class EvictionTimer { /** Executor instance */ private static ScheduledThreadPoolExecutor executor; //@GuardedBy("EvictionTimer.class") /** Prevent instantiation */ private EvictionTimer() { // Hide the default constructor } /** * @since 2.4.3 */ @Override public String toString() { final StringBuilder builder = new StringBuilder(); builder.append("EvictionTimer []"); return builder.toString(); } /** * Add the specified eviction task to the timer. Tasks that are added with a * call to this method *must* call {@link #cancel(TimerTask)} to cancel the * task to prevent memory and/or thread leaks in application server * environments. * * @param task Task to be scheduled * @param delay Delay in milliseconds before task is executed * @param period Time in milliseconds between executions */ static synchronized void schedule( final BaseGenericObjectPool.Evictor task, final long delay, final long period) { if (null == executor) { executor = new ScheduledThreadPoolExecutor(1, new EvictorThreadFactory()); executor.setRemoveOnCancelPolicy(true); } final ScheduledFuture scheduledFuture = executor.scheduleWithFixedDelay(task, delay, period, T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S); task.setScheduledFuture(scheduledFuture); } /** * Remove the specified eviction task from the timer. * * @param task Task to be cancelled * @param timeout If the associated executor is no longer required, how * long should this thread wait for the executor to * terminate? * @param unit The units for the specified timeout */ static synchronized void cancel( final BaseGenericObjectPool.Evictor task, final long timeout, final TimeUnit unit) { task.cancel(); if (executor != null && executor.getQueue().isEmpty()) { executor.shutdown(); try { executor.awaitTermination(timeout, unit); } catch (final InterruptedException e) { // Swallow // Significant API changes would be required to propagate this } executor.setCorePoolSize(0); executor = null; } } /** * Thread factory that creates a thread, with the context class loader from this class. */ private static class EvictorThreadFactory implements ThreadFactory { @Override public Thread newThread(final Runnable runnable) { final Thread thread = new Thread(null, runnable, "commons-pool-evictor-thread"); AccessController.doPrivileged(new PrivilegedAction() { @Override public Void run() { thread.setContextClassLoader(EvictorThreadFactory.class.getClassLoader()); return null; } }); return thread; } } }
